Troubleshooting The Command Phasescriptexecution Failed Error

//

Thomas

Affiliate disclosure: As an Amazon Associate, we may earn commissions from qualifying Amazon.com purchases

Discover the , steps, and common for the Command phasescriptexecution failed with a nonzero exit code error. Fix the error and continue with your development process smoothly.

Understanding the Command phasescriptexecution Failed Error

Causes of the Command phasescriptexecution Failed Error

The “Command phasescriptexecution failed” error is a common issue that developers may encounter while building and running their Xcode projects. This error typically occurs during the build process when a script fails to execute successfully. There are several potential for this error, including:

  • Syntax Errors in the Script: One possible cause of the error is a syntax error within the script itself. This could be a missing or misplaced character, an incorrect variable name, or an invalid command. These syntax errors can prevent the script from running properly, resulting in the “Command phasescriptexecution failed” error.
  • Incorrect Permissions for the Script: Another potential cause of the error is incorrect permissions for the script file. If the script does not have the necessary permissions to execute, Xcode will be unable to run it during the build process, leading to the error. It is important to ensure that the script file has the correct permissions set to allow execution.
  • Missing Dependencies: The error may also occur if the script relies on external dependencies that are not installed or configured properly. If the script requires certain libraries, frameworks, or tools to be present, but they are missing or not set up correctly, the script will fail to execute and trigger the error.
  • Insufficient Disk Space: In some cases, the error may be caused by insufficient disk space on the machine running Xcode. When the build process requires temporary files or resources to be created, but there is not enough free disk space available, the script may fail to execute and result in the error.

Troubleshooting the Command phasescriptexecution Failed Error

When facing the “Command phasescriptexecution failed” error, it is essential to troubleshoot the issue to identify the root cause and find a solution. Here are some steps you can take:

  • Reviewing the Script Output: Start by carefully reviewing the output of the script to understand any error messages or warnings that are being generated. These messages can provide valuable insights into the specific issue causing the error. Look for any indications of syntax errors, permission problems, or missing dependencies.
  • Checking the Script Execution Environment: Ensure that the script’s execution environment is properly set up. This includes verifying that any required tools or libraries are installed and correctly configured. Check for any conflicting configurations or settings that may interfere with the script’s execution.
  • Verifying Dependencies and Their Versions: Double-check that all required dependencies for the script are present and up to date. Ensure that the correct versions of libraries, frameworks, or tools are installed. In some cases, it may be necessary to update or reinstall dependencies to resolve compatibility issues.
  • Analyzing System Logs for Clues: If the error remains unresolved, analyzing system logs can provide additional insights. Look for any relevant error messages or warnings in the system logs that may shed light on the root cause of the issue. These logs can be found in various locations depending on the operating system being used.

Common Solutions for the Command phasescriptexecution Failed Error

Fortunately, there are several common that can help resolve the “Command phasescriptexecution failed” error. Consider trying the following approaches:

  • Updating Xcode and Command Line Tools: Ensure that you have the latest version of Xcode and its associated Command Line Tools installed. Updating to the latest versions can address any known issues or bugs that may be causing the error.
  • Fixing Syntax Errors in the Script: Carefully review the script for any syntax errors and correct them accordingly. Pay attention to missing characters, incorrect variable names, or invalid commands. Fixing these syntax errors can allow the script to execute successfully.
  • Granting Correct Permissions to the Script: Verify that the script file has the appropriate permissions to execute. Use the chmod command or the file properties settings to grant the necessary execution permissions to the script.
  • Installing Missing Dependencies: If the script relies on external dependencies, make sure they are installed and properly configured. Use package managers or installation scripts to install any missing libraries, frameworks, or tools that are required by the script.

By understanding the , steps, and common for the “Command phasescriptexecution failed” error, developers can effectively address this issue and continue with their Xcode projects seamlessly.


Possible Causes of a Nonzero Exit Code

When encountering a nonzero exit code error during script execution, there are several potential that could be contributing to the issue. Understanding these can help in and resolving the error efficiently. Let’s explore some of the common culprits:

Syntax Errors in the Script

One of the primary for a nonzero exit code error is the presence of syntax errors within the script itself. These errors could include missing or incorrect syntax elements, such as misplaced brackets or semicolons. Additionally, typos or misspelled keywords can also result in syntax errors. It is crucial to carefully review the script code and identify any syntax-related issues.

Incorrect Permissions for the Script

Another possible cause of a nonzero exit code error is incorrect permissions set for the script. If the script does not have the necessary permissions to execute, it can lead to a failure with a nonzero exit code. To resolve this issue, it is essential to ensure that the script has the appropriate permissions assigned to it, allowing it to be executed by the system.

Missing Dependencies

The presence of missing dependencies can also contribute to a nonzero exit code error. Dependencies refer to external libraries, modules, or software that the script relies on to function correctly. If these dependencies are not installed or configured properly, the script may encounter errors and fail with a nonzero exit code. Verifying the presence and compatibility of all required dependencies is crucial to avoid such errors.

Insufficient Disk Space

Insufficient disk space on the system can be another culprit behind a nonzero exit code error. When a script requires disk space to perform certain operations, such as writing or reading files, and there is not enough space available, the script execution can fail with a nonzero exit code. It is important to monitor and ensure sufficient disk space is available to prevent such errors from occurring.

By understanding these possible of a nonzero exit code error, you can effectively troubleshoot and resolve the issue. Next, we will delve into techniques specific to addressing this error.


Troubleshooting the Nonzero Exit Code Error

When encountering the “Nonzero Exit Code” error during script execution, there are several steps you can take to identify and resolve the issue. By reviewing the script output, checking the script execution environment, verifying dependencies and their versions, and analyzing system logs for clues, you can effectively troubleshoot and resolve this error.

Reviewing the Script Output

One of the first steps in the Nonzero Exit Code error is to review the script output. The script output provides valuable information about any errors or issues encountered during execution. By carefully examining the output, you can identify the specific error message or error code that caused the Nonzero Exit Code error. Look for any syntax errors or warnings that may have occurred during the execution.

Checking the Script Execution Environment

Another important aspect to consider when the Nonzero Exit Code error is the script execution environment. Ensure that the script is being executed in the appropriate environment with the necessary permissions. Check if the script has the correct file permissions and is being executed with the required user privileges. Additionally, verify that the script is being executed with the correct version of the required software or tools.

Verifying Dependencies and Their Versions

Dependencies play a crucial role in script execution. It is essential to verify that all the required dependencies are installed and their versions are compatible with the script. Check if any dependencies are missing or if there are any conflicts between different versions of the same dependency. By ensuring that all dependencies are present and up to date, you can minimize the chances of encountering a Nonzero Exit Code error.

Analyzing System Logs for Clues

System logs can provide valuable insights into the cause of the Nonzero Exit Code error. By analyzing the system logs, you can identify any system-level issues or conflicts that may have occurred during script execution. Look for any error messages, warnings, or inconsistencies in the logs that may point to the root cause of the error. System logs can offer clues about issues such as insufficient disk space, resource conflicts, or other system-related problems.

By following these steps – reviewing the script output, checking the script execution environment, verifying dependencies and their versions, and analyzing system logs for clues – you can effectively diagnose and resolve the Nonzero Exit Code error. Remember to approach the process systematically and document any findings or changes made along the way.


Common Solutions for the Nonzero Exit Code Error

Updating Xcode and Command Line Tools

Keeping Xcode and Command Line Tools up to date is essential for resolving the nonzero exit code error. These tools provide the necessary libraries, frameworks, and compilers required for script execution. By updating them, you ensure compatibility with the latest operating system updates and bug fixes. Here’s how you can update Xcode and Command Line Tools:

  1. Updating Xcode: Launch the App Store on your Mac and go to the Updates section. If there’s an available update for Xcode, click on the Update button next to it. Follow the on-screen instructions to install the latest version of Xcode.
  2. Updating Command Line Tools: Open Terminal and run the following command: xcode-select –install. This command will prompt you to install the Command Line Tools if they’re not already installed. Follow the prompts to complete the installation.

Fixing Syntax Errors in the Script

Syntax errors in the script can cause the nonzero exit code error. These errors occur when the script contains incorrect or invalid commands, variables, or function calls. To fix syntax errors, you need to carefully review the script and identify the problematic sections. Here are some steps to help you troubleshoot and fix syntax errors:

  1. Review the script: Read through the script line by line, paying close attention to any error messages or warnings. Look for typos, missing or extra characters, and incorrect formatting.
  2. Use a code editor or IDE: Use a code editor or integrated development environment (IDE) that provides syntax highlighting and error checking. This will help you identify syntax errors more easily.
  3. Consult the script documentation: If you’re using a script provided by a third-party or a library, refer to the documentation for guidance on correct syntax usage.
  4. Test small sections of the script: If you’re unable to identify the syntax error, try testing small sections of the script individually. This can help pinpoint the exact line or section causing the error.

Granting Correct Permissions to the Script

Incorrect permissions for the script can prevent it from executing properly and result in a nonzero exit code error. To resolve this issue, you need to ensure that the script has the correct permissions set. Here’s how you can grant the correct permissions to the script:

  1. Check current permissions: Use the ls -l command in Terminal to list the permissions of the script. The output will show the owner, group, and permissions for the file.
  2. Modify permissions: Use the chmod command followed by the desired permission settings to modify the permissions of the script. For example, to grant read, write, and execute permissions to the owner, use the command chmod u+rwx script.sh.
  3. Verify permissions: Use the ls -l command again to confirm that the permissions have been successfully changed for the script.

Installing Missing Dependencies

Missing dependencies can lead to a nonzero exit code error as the script relies on certain libraries or packages that are not installed on the system. To fix this issue, you need to identify the missing dependencies and install them. Here’s how you can install missing dependencies:

  1. Identify missing dependencies: Review any error messages or warnings related to missing dependencies in the script output. These messages often mention the specific libraries or packages that are required but not found.
  2. Use package managers: If the missing dependencies are available through package managers like Homebrew (for macOS) or apt-get (for Linux), use the respective package manager to install them. For example, with Homebrew, you can run brew install <dependency> to install the missing dependency.
  3. Compile from source: If the missing dependencies are not available through package managers, you may need to compile them from source. This process involves downloading the source code, configuring, building, and installing it manually. Refer to the documentation or website of the missing dependency for detailed instructions on how to compile and install it.

By following these common , you can effectively address the nonzero exit code error and ensure smooth script execution. Remember to update Xcode and Command Line Tools, fix syntax errors, grant correct permissions, and install any missing dependencies to resolve the issue.

Leave a Comment

Contact

3418 Emily Drive
Charlotte, SC 28217

+1 803-820-9654
About Us
Contact Us
Privacy Policy

Connect

Subscribe

Join our email list to receive the latest updates.